Responsibilities

Histotechnology: Participate in the accessioning, grossing, embedding, processing of traditional histological tissue samples as well as novel complex in vitro model samples.

Team Leadership & Personnel Management: Directly supervise, mentor, and develop a team of histotechnologists and laboratory technicians. Conduct performance evaluations, establish individual development plans, oversee scheduling and workload allocation, and foster a collaborative, inclusive, and psychologically safe team culture.

Workflow Oversight & Operational Management: Plan, coordinate, and prioritize laboratory workflows to ensure timely delivery of histological services in support of drug discovery and translational research programs. Monitor laboratory capacity and adjust resource allocation as needed to meet project milestones and organizational objectives. Be the point of contact for troubleshooting the newly implemented laboratory management information system employed in the laboratory (SampleManger).

Quality Assurance & Regulatory Compliance: Establish, maintain, and continuously improve quality management systems, including SOPs, quality control protocols, and laboratory metrics.

Resource & Budget Management: Oversee procurement, maintenance, and qualification of laboratory equipment, reagents, and consumables.

Training & Mentorship: Provide technical training in histological techniques including tissue trimming, processing, embedding, FFPE and cryosectioning, routine and special staining, and advanced molecular tissue-based assays.

Laboratory Safety: Enforce safe handling of hazardous chemicals, biological specimens, and sharp instruments. Lead incident investigations, and corrective action implementation in compliance with EHS policies.

Cross-Functional Collaboration & Scientific Support: Partner with pathologists, research scientists, and program managers to understand project needs and deliver tailored histological solutions.

Continuous Improvement & Innovation: Identify and implement improvements to existing workflows, technologies, and methodologies. Evaluate and qualify new platforms and reagents, and champion the adoption of emerging histological and digital pathology technologies aligned with the group's scientific strategy.
